CO2 EMISSION, ECONOMIC GROWTH AND ENERGY CONSUMPTION IN INDIA: A VAR ANALYSIS

Bishnu Charan Behera

Abstract

The present paper tries to see the causal relationship among emission of carbon dioxide (Co2), GDP (Economic Growth) and energy consumption (Oil) in India. The secondary data has been collected from various issues of Economic survey of India, GoI, various issues of Energy statistics, GoI, and data published by the World Bank on India. The VAR (Vector Auto Regression Model) has been applied due to absence of long-run relationship among variables. The study also found that there is no causality among the variables. The Government of India should take necessary steps to attain efficiency in energy use while preserving it and steps to be taken for lesser use of fossil fuels.
